1. KNOW YOUR STYLE

Your senior portraits should reflect who you are. Are you laid-back and outdoorsy? Trendy and bold? Sporty, artistic, or all of the above? Think about the overall vibe you want—whether it's urban, rustic, beachy, or classic—and find a photographer whose style matches your vision.


2. Plan Ahead

Popular photographers book up quickly—especially during peak seasons like spring and fall. It’s best to secure your session date early so you have plenty of time to prepare. Plus, you’ll want to make sure your images are ready in time for yearbook deadlines, graduation announcements, and keepsakes.


3. Outfits Matter

Wardrobe plays a huge role in how your photos turn out. Choose 2–3 outfits that make you feel confident and comfortable. Mix things up with different styles—maybe something casual, something dressy, and something that represents your personality. Don’t forget to consider colors that compliment your skin tone and surroundings!


4. Location Sets the Tone

The location you choose can add a ton of personality to your images. Do you love the beach, the forest, a downtown vibe, or maybe your school’s sports field? We’ll work together to pick a spot (or two!) that fits your style and tells your story.
